Handover note — Crumbwheel order cutoffs.

Welcome aboard. The bakery cutoff rule in Crumbwheel closes same-day orders at 14:00 local to each storefront, not UTC — this has bitten us twice. Holiday overrides live in the calendar service and take precedence silently, so always check there first when a cutoff looks wrong. To unlock the calendar service's admin console after a restart, enter the recovery passphrase below.

vault phrase of bagap-bahaf = silion-pelox-sorox-casdor-quenwyn-fraax-eliox-praael-kelion-quenvan-kasox-rusael-norius-belvan

## Dependency pinning

Welcome aboard. On Fernley we pin everything — exact versions, no ranges, no exceptions. We learned this the hard way when a transitive bump broke the billing worker on a Friday. The lockfile is the source of truth; if you want to upgrade something, open a pinning PR and let the compatibility suite run overnight. Never hand-edit the lockfile in a hotfix branch. When you cut a release, verify the pinned bundle's signature against the current release key, which is below.

signing key of bagap-yawep = bky13_TbfT6ZMUoGJo2

- [ ] **Step 7: Breaker override escrow.** After sealing the signing keys for the Tallgrove upstream API circuit breaker, confirm the support team can force the breaker open during a full outage. The override bundle lives in the sealed escrow drawer and is useless without its unlock phrase. Two ceremony witnesses must initial this step before proceeding. The escrow bundle is decrypted with the recovery passphrase that follows.

vault phrase of kahip-kahop = holath-quenmir

Facilities Ticket — Cleaning Crew Access, Brindle Annex

For new starters handling evening lock-up: the Sorano Cleaning crew arrives nightly at 21:30 via the annex side door. Check their rota sheet, note arrival in the log, and ensure the storeroom is relocked afterward. To let them through the side door, enter the access code below.

badge for yaweg-hafog: bdg-GX-6